Salvatore Mesoraca
cb00020504
vulkan : mul_mat: fix UB with small warps (ggml/952)
When the device's warp size is less than 16,
it is possible for loadstride_a (mul_mm.comp:114)
and loadstride_b (mul_mm.comp:115) to be set to 0.
Because they are calculated as: the workgroup size,
multiplied by LOAD_VEC_* (which can be 1) and divided by 16.
And the workgroup size is set to be the same as the
warp/subgroup size.

The loadstride_* variables are used as increments in the
loops that populate the buffers used for the multiplication.

When they are 0 they cause an infinite loop.
But infinite loops without side-effects are UB and the
values of loadstride_* are known at compile time.
So, the compiler quietly optimizes all the loops away.
As a consequence, the buffers are not populated and
the multiplication result is just a matrix with all elements
set to 0.

We prevent the UB by making sure that the workgroup size
will never be less than 16, even if our device has a
smaller warp size (e.g. 8).

Markus Tavenrath
7c5bfd57f8
Optimize Vulkan backend for better CPU performance and less GPU synchronization overhead. (#8943)
* Optimize Vulkan backend for better CPU performance and less GPU synchronization overhead.

- Allocation overhead for the temporary std::vectors was easily detectable with a sampling profiler and simple to remove.
- ggml_vk_sync_buffer introduce a full pipeline sync which has a significant cost on the GPU side, sometimes larger than the actual kernel execution. Adding only barriers for shader read/writes and transfers seems to be sufficient looking at the code which either launches compute kernels or copies tensors.

Tony Wasserka
203b7f1531 vulkan : initialize vk_buffer_struct members to VK_NULL_HANDLE (ggml/893)
This prevents invalid frees when destroying a partially initialized
vk_buffer_struct. For example, this could happen in ggml_vk_create_buffer
when running out of device memory.
